We currently have a full-time position available for an apprentice Reefer Technician at our Salisbury location.
We’re looking for a Transport Refrigeration Service Technician responsible for the repair and maintenance of our ever growing Rental fleet of commercial trailers. This job requires physical strength, including heavy lifting, frequent bending, and working in tight spaces.
Responsibilities and requirements:
- Diagnose, troubleshoot, install, maintain, and repair refrigeration systems and accessories on commercial trailers
- Repair mechanical, electrical, and refrigeration components, including Freon recharge, leak detection, and part replacement (may involve soldering, welding, and repairing leaks)
- Read and interpret schematics, blueprints, and technical manuals
- Perform scheduled maintenance and inspections to ensure units operate within required parameters for proper cargo temperature control
- Estimate parts and labor costs, review work orders, and consult with the Service Advisor as needed
- Accurately document service calls, maintenance activities, and repairs performed
- Deliver excellent customer service when interacting with clients on-site
- Willingness to participate in new product Technology
Qualifications:
- Proven experience as a Service Technician in transport refrigeration or HVAC trade
- Ozone Depletion Certification (ODC)
- Valid Class 5 driver’s license
- Possess own tools
- Proficient in computer diagnostics and repair
- Strong organizational and problem-solving abilities
- Capable of working independently and collaboratively within a team
- Commitment to staying current with industry trends and technological advancements
- Adherence to safety standards and regulatory requirements
